Category: Integrated Circuit (IC)
Use: Voltage Regulator
Characteristics: - Low dropout voltage - High output voltage accuracy - Low quiescent current - Thermal shutdown protection - Overcurrent protection
Package: SOT-23-5
Essence: The S-1112B50MC-L6JTFG is a voltage regulator IC designed to provide a stable output voltage for various electronic devices.

The S-1112B50MC-L6JTFG operates as a linear voltage regulator. It regulates the input voltage to a stable 5.0V output voltage by utilizing an internal reference voltage and feedback control mechanism.
